The head is parted together. The power amp chassis is from a mid 70's SVT. The preamp chassis is from an earlier version. Magnavox did use old parts stock throughout the 70's, so there is a possibility it's factory stock, but it is most defintiely NOT a late 60's SVT.  It's overpriced, but not as outrightly fraudent as a lot of Craigslist stuff.
